Output 83f8c4c59dace54bb7937cbe528b25c0597a280ac527790cddbf822402868079:0

value
17430000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c50ce6eba2c91fe277286d0672125ddb0de415c1 OP_EQUAL
address
MRs4ofoJ2zextH8TxjeDZS2PGWo4JUv5VV
transaction
83f8c4c59dace54bb7937cbe528b25c0597a280ac527790cddbf822402868079
spent
true